Commit graph

  • 126262edb3 Merge 13.0->trunk master Kim Alvefur 2025-04-01 18:31:26 +02:00
  • 7976f21e3e mod_s2s: Deal with OpenSSL changing spelling in strings 13.0 Kim Alvefur 2025-04-01 18:15:34 +02:00
  • c914afdc49 mod_tls: Enable Prosody's certificate checking for incoming s2s connections (fixes #1916) (thanks Damian, Zash) Matthew Wild 2025-04-01 17:26:56 +01:00
  • e39d14c8e8 prosodyctl: Fix spacing in warning message Matthew Wild 2025-04-01 14:38:37 +01:00
  • d4af16441d Merge 13.0->trunk Kim Alvefur 2025-03-31 21:23:35 +02:00
  • f0c6467af8 mod_roster: Fix shell commands when a component is involved (fixes #1908) Kim Alvefur 2025-03-31 21:19:14 +02:00
  • 9f728624b2 Merge 13.0->trunk Matthew Wild 2025-03-31 17:32:11 +01:00
  • f0042849ba mod_admin_shell, prosodyctl shell: Report command failure when no password entered (fixes #1907) Matthew Wild 2025-03-31 17:30:50 +01:00
  • ce9fa7d874 Merge 13.0->trunk Matthew Wild 2025-03-31 16:43:06 +01:00
  • 4f94d2425d util.adminstream: Fix traceback on double-close (fixes #1913) Matthew Wild 2025-03-31 16:25:09 +01:00
  • 5e1352f983 Merge 13.0->trunk Matthew Wild 2025-03-31 12:21:22 +01:00
  • 96aadab60b core.portmanager: Restore use of per-host 'ssl' for SNI hosts. Fixes #1915. Kim Alvefur 2025-03-29 22:25:19 +01:00
  • 3d5416fa91 Merge 13.0->trunk Kim Alvefur 2025-03-23 20:19:09 +01:00
  • be51e54c68 doap: Add XEP-0333 Kim Alvefur 2025-03-23 19:59:45 +01:00
  • 780b392d25 doap: Add XEP-0334 Kim Alvefur 2025-03-23 19:57:06 +01:00
  • 4068c28023 doap: Add XEP-0156 and mod_http_altconnect Kim Alvefur 2025-03-23 19:47:34 +01:00
  • d3899c1e16 Merge 13.0->trunk Kim Alvefur 2025-03-23 17:24:49 +01:00
  • faed304d55 mod_http_file_share: Explicitly reject all unsupported ranges Kim Alvefur 2025-03-23 12:36:47 +01:00
  • afd99708d6 mod_http_file_share: Fix off by one in Range response Kim Alvefur 2025-03-23 12:21:19 +01:00
  • b9d4cc24df mod_storage_sql: Drop legacy index without confirmation to ease upgrades Kim Alvefur 2025-03-23 12:15:16 +01:00
  • 244220453d Merge 13.0->trunk Kim Alvefur 2025-03-22 11:56:23 +01:00
  • 6959547703 core.usermanager: Fix COMPAT layer for legacy is_admin() function Kim Alvefur 2025-03-22 11:53:15 +01:00
  • 0ed2d38edf core.storagemanager: Fix tests by removing an assert that upset luarocks Kim Alvefur 2025-03-19 16:15:52 +01:00
  • eacf72504c mod_storage_sql: Fix indentation Kim Alvefur 2025-03-19 16:13:32 +01:00
  • 8a4d96bb71 Merge 13.0->trunk Matthew Wild 2025-03-17 16:49:22 +00:00
  • 3d74ce8584 prosodyctl check: Be more robust against invalid disco_items, and show warning Matthew Wild 2025-03-17 16:48:39 +00:00
  • 8bcd4f6807 Merge 13.0->trunk Kim Alvefur 2025-03-17 15:23:50 +01:00
  • 780fd208bc mod_http_file_share: Improve error reporting by using util.error more Kim Alvefur 2025-03-16 15:20:45 +01:00
  • 614ca69407 Merge 13.0->trunk Matthew Wild 2025-03-13 13:11:57 +00:00
  • 6bf45cacf9 Added tag 13.0.0 for changeset a8ad0741632d Matthew Wild 2025-03-13 13:11:22 +00:00
  • 421afd79f4 CHANGES: 13.0.0 release date 13.0.0 Matthew Wild 2025-03-13 13:11:05 +00:00
  • 287349f2eb CHANGES: Fix 13.0.0 version number Matthew Wild 2025-03-13 13:10:22 +00:00
  • 77fb638f4d Merge 13.0->trunk Matthew Wild 2025-03-13 11:41:32 +00:00
  • 57d168dd5e prosodyctl shell: More reliable detection of REPL/interactive mode (fixes #1895) Matthew Wild 2025-03-13 11:37:11 +00:00
  • 384e3dbea2 mod_admin_shell: Remove outdated help text (fixes #1898) Matthew Wild 2025-03-13 11:35:39 +00:00
  • 04bd8258ef prosodyctl check features: Report size limit for HTTP upload Matthew Wild 2025-03-13 11:33:08 +00:00
  • 9f50add34e prosodyctl check features: Add descriptions to features Matthew Wild 2025-03-13 11:32:22 +00:00
  • 74970e2815 Merge 13.0->trunk Matthew Wild 2025-03-11 18:45:23 +00:00
  • 8005ac825f mod_websocket: Merge session close handling changes from mod_c2s (bug fixes) Matthew Wild 2025-03-11 18:44:40 +00:00
  • 5b4624137d mod_c2s: Code formatting change Matthew Wild 2025-03-11 18:37:16 +00:00
  • 5b1d83614b CHANGES: Add list of new modules Matthew Wild 2025-03-11 18:27:54 +00:00
  • 06994f0bc1 util.argparse: Fix bug (regression?) in argument parsing with --foo=bar Matthew Wild 2025-03-11 18:27:36 +00:00
  • afb9bc34a0 mod_storage_internal: Use UUIDv7 for message ids Matthew Wild 2025-03-10 11:54:52 +00:00
  • e66265d65a usermanager: Add info logging for all usermanager account changes Matthew Wild 2025-03-10 11:52:55 +00:00
  • 53774a4234 Merge 13.0->trunk Matthew Wild 2025-03-06 13:34:55 +00:00
  • 86341e87d3 util.sasl: Preserve 'userdata' field between clones Matthew Wild 2025-03-06 13:34:37 +00:00
  • 9f9cc1ea09 Merge 13.0->trunk Matthew Wild 2025-03-01 16:19:58 +00:00
  • 830f3e122c mod_external_services: Also use TURN REST credential algo for 'turns' (thanks moreroid) Matthew Wild 2025-03-01 16:19:43 +00:00
  • 08e6a1455b Merge 13.0->trunk Kim Alvefur 2025-02-27 21:38:00 +01:00
  • c769eae82b net.server_epoll: Improve readability of DANE noise Kim Alvefur 2025-02-27 21:36:43 +01:00
  • 7bf3a56ec6 Merge 13.0->trunk Matthew Wild 2025-02-24 17:49:55 +00:00
  • faf20e5dc9 certmanager: Add more debug logging around cert indexing Matthew Wild 2025-02-24 17:48:58 +00:00
  • 70ee43995c Merge 13.0->trunk Kim Alvefur 2025-02-22 21:49:59 +01:00
  • e52cc0126d mod_component: Don't return error reply for errors, fixes #1897 Kim Alvefur 2025-02-22 21:48:07 +01:00
  • 68296b6a8e mod_bosh,mod_websocket: Don't load mod_http_altconnect in global context Kim Alvefur 2025-02-22 21:45:34 +01:00
  • 4537e07daa Merge 13.0->trunk Matthew Wild 2025-02-22 09:41:29 +00:00
  • 783c8fcc81 prosodyctl: check features: stop searching after finding a matching component Matthew Wild 2025-02-22 09:35:04 +00:00
  • 263b7e1e16 Merge 13.0->trunk Kim Alvefur 2025-02-22 00:26:35 +01:00
  • 6b1e056142 core.configmanager: Pass name and line number in context Kim Alvefur 2025-02-22 00:04:51 +01:00
  • 5e41daac79 core.configmanager: Fix reporting delayed warnings from global section Kim Alvefur 2025-02-22 00:08:18 +01:00
  • 9eedb15c6f core.configmanager: Remove dependency on 'prosody' global for Credential Kim Alvefur 2025-02-22 00:00:41 +01:00
  • bde377c10a Merge 13.0->trunk Matthew Wild 2025-02-17 23:06:26 +00:00
  • 13dc010593 mod_invites: Hide --group flag unless mod_invites_groups is enabled Matthew Wild 2025-02-17 23:06:06 +00:00
  • edc68f5407 mod_invites: Fix traceback when no flags passed Matthew Wild 2025-02-17 22:57:58 +00:00
  • 7b6ff43ec4 Merge 13.0->trunk Matthew Wild 2025-02-17 19:22:54 +00:00
  • 764c388d38 mod_invites: Deprecate 'mod_invites generate' in favour of new shell commands Matthew Wild 2025-02-17 19:12:40 +00:00
  • 6855f5c8c3 mod_admin_shell: Improve help listing in non-REPL mode Matthew Wild 2025-02-17 19:10:48 +00:00
  • 75b8824b00 mod_admin_shell: Fix simple command execution (e.g. help) Matthew Wild 2025-02-17 19:10:26 +00:00
  • efc31d66ef mod_admin_shell: Set flag on session when in REPL mode Matthew Wild 2025-02-17 19:09:11 +00:00
  • c8cf32b614 mod_admin_shell: Improved error handling for shell-invoked commands Matthew Wild 2025-02-17 18:25:52 +00:00
  • 43be6cb1c6 util.argparse: Add strict mode + tests Matthew Wild 2025-02-17 18:24:23 +00:00
  • 79381510cf mod_admin_shell, util.prosodyctl.shell: Process command-line args on server-side, with argparse support Matthew Wild 2025-02-17 17:02:35 +00:00
  • edafb195e1 util.argparse: Optionally continue processing past positional parameters Matthew Wild 2025-02-17 16:38:48 +00:00
  • 12790afdf0 Merge 13.0->trunk Kim Alvefur 2025-02-17 12:37:58 +01:00
  • fb80b33824 Merge 13.0->trunk Matthew Wild 2025-02-17 11:36:26 +00:00
  • 5cdef4e2cc Merge 13.0->trunk Kim Alvefur 2025-02-17 01:01:54 +01:00
  • 2c39c676ce Merge 13.0->trunk Matthew Wild 2025-02-16 14:29:02 +00:00
  • 14c171ab61 Merge 13.0->trunk Matthew Wild 2025-02-16 13:44:23 +00:00
  • 5c2dbef89d Merge 13.0->trunk Kim Alvefur 2025-02-16 11:57:18 +01:00
  • 1b8170a1d2 Merge 13.0->trunk Matthew Wild 2025-02-15 17:13:23 +00:00
  • 8a12586fc7 Merge 13.0->trunk Matthew Wild 2025-02-15 16:48:45 +00:00
  • 645c9dfca8 Merge 13.0->trunk Matthew Wild 2025-02-15 16:40:26 +00:00
  • 7b02dd0ed1 Merge 13.0->trunk Kim Alvefur 2025-02-15 16:57:31 +01:00
  • 6218150e93 Merge 13.0->trunk Matthew Wild 2025-02-15 10:34:26 +00:00
  • 1de0007141 Merge 13.0->trunk Kim Alvefur 2025-02-14 20:57:43 +01:00
  • 8333f04d22 Merge 13.0->trunk Matthew Wild 2025-02-14 14:54:49 +00:00
  • 5cb42c94bd Merge 13.0->trunk Matthew Wild 2025-02-13 18:01:43 +00:00
  • 1d130946fe Merge 13.0->trunk Matthew Wild 2025-02-13 17:05:51 +00:00
  • 468537cb09 Merge 13.0->trunk Matthew Wild 2025-02-13 16:21:10 +00:00
  • ecf23b8390 Merge 13.0->trunk Matthew Wild 2025-02-13 14:00:34 +00:00
  • 64c5d4941c Merge 13.0->trunk Matthew Wild 2025-02-13 13:09:11 +00:00
  • 213dbebdd2 Merge 13.0->trunk Kim Alvefur 2025-02-12 22:41:19 +01:00
  • 4edcb2f344 Merge 13.0->trunk Matthew Wild 2025-02-12 17:16:09 +00:00
  • e0fc00a04c Merge 13.0->trunk Matthew Wild 2025-02-12 12:34:29 +00:00
  • 5de57b973b EOL 0.11 0.11 Kim Alvefur 2024-08-22 16:13:57 +02:00
  • b8e4d5e840 util.x509: Per RFC 9525, remove obsolete Common Name check Kim Alvefur 2024-02-11 13:34:13 +01:00
  • 2c0af0666b prosodyctl: check features: Fix traceback for components with no recommended modules (thanks Menel, riau) Matthew Wild 2025-02-17 11:35:03 +00:00
  • f21ea48481 mod_invites: Fix storing --group (thanks lissine) Kim Alvefur 2025-02-17 00:55:27 +01:00
  • 3ba87d07a9 util.prosodyctl.check: Recognise http_upload_external as a file upload service Matthew Wild 2025-02-16 14:19:16 +00:00
  • f7f794c5c6 util.prosodyctl.check: Fix typo in informational message Matthew Wild 2025-02-16 14:17:11 +00:00